What's your idea? I agree that monarch is where barbs really start to become a nuisance. I think emperor barbs are actually harder than immortal, only because the AI expands so quickly that the barbs don't have much of a window.

Well, I watched a Youtube game a little while back that discussed how Barb-spawning and Barb city-settling mechanics work (they don't spawn within 2 squares of a unit and don't settle within 1 square of a unit, iirc) and it just struck me that it's something that is a key part of learning the game at higher levels but not often discussed. Generally people just say that they got choked off by barbs and rage-quit.
